Join our Volunteen program at Cleburne Public Library. Gain valuable experience and contribute to your community. This position is geared towards enthusiastic and responsible teenagers (14-18 years) to help library staff with a variety of tasks, support library programs, and assist patrons with computer related tasks.

Mission Statement

The mission of the Cleburne Public Library is to assist citizens in meeting their differing informational needs through a variety of formats, and to also promote lifelong learning, by providing equal access to educational, cultural, and recreational materials and programs.

Description

Cleburne Public Library- We provide programming for children and youth through weekly story times, summer reading programs, seasonal and informational programs. Adult programming consists of monthly book reviews, book clubs, special interest programs, and computer classes. Assistance is provided in searching the Internet, resume and job searching and genealogy research. Homebound material delivery is also provided. The library also participates in Inter-library loans, Internet access, online databases and word processing. The library is used regularly by various community groups.
